🏅 HISTORY IN MOTION
The starter’s horn sounded at Great Lakes Secondary School—and with it, a new LKDSB tradition was born.
For the first time, 531 elementary student athletes from across our entire bard came together for a unified Track & Field Meet— with representation stretching from Wheatley to Grand Bend.
From powerful sprints to soaring jumps and electrifying relays, the day was filled with determination, sportsmanship, and unforgettable moments. Even more impactful? Students competing alongside peers they’d never met before, building connections that reached far beyond the finish line.
This wasn’t just a meet—it was the beginning of something bigger for LKDSB students.
